What Is The Sunshine Health Rewards Card And How Does It Work?
The Sunshine Health Rewards Card is a prepaid Visa® card that allows members to earn and use rewards for completing health-related activities. It is part of the My Health Pays® Rewards Program, which encourages preventive care and wellness. Members can earn rewards by completing annual check-ups, screenings, immunizations, and health coaching programs. These rewards can then be used for essential expenses such as household bills, transportation, rent, childcare, education, and shopping at Walmart.

However, this card is not a regular debit card and comes with restrictions. It cannot be used for alcohol, tobacco, firearms, or cash withdrawals. To keep track of their rewards, members can easily check their balance through the Sunshine Health app or website. How To Earn My Health Pays® Rewards?
If you’re looking for an easy way to earn rewards while taking care of your health, the My Health Pays® program has you covered! By completing simple health-related activities, you can earn rewards that help pay for essential expenses. Here’s how you can start earning today.

Health Coaching Programs:
Making healthy choices is easier when you have guidance. By joining health coaching programs, you can earn rewards while improving your well-being. If you commit to quitting tobacco, you can earn $20 per year. Those focusing on weight management can receive $20 annually. Additionally, completing substance use treatment can earn you $10 per year, supporting your journey to better health.
Preventative Care Programs:
Prevention is key to staying healthy, and the rewards program encourages regular check-ups. Completing an annual well-child visit earns $30 per year, while getting the necessary immunizations for children and adolescents provides $20-$30 per lifetime. Women who undergo a mammogram screening can earn $20 per year, while those completing colorectal cancer or osteoporosis screenings also receive $10-$20 annually.
Pregnancy Programs:
Expecting mothers deserve extra support, and the rewards program recognizes that. Completing prenatal visits can earn $50 per year, ensuring both mom and baby get the care they need. After delivery, attending a postpartum visit within the recommended time frame provides $40 per year. Additionally, getting the Tdap vaccine during pregnancy earns $20 annually, helping protect both mother and child.
Chronic Conditions & Mental Health Management:
Managing chronic conditions is essential for long-term health, and you can earn rewards while doing so. If you have diabetes, completing an HbA1c test or dilated eye exam earns $10-$20 per year. Those with sickle cell disease can earn $20 annually by visiting a specialist. Additionally, completing mental health follow-ups within seven days of an inpatient or emergency room visit can earn $20 per visit (up to twice a year).

Chronic Conditions & Mental Health Programs – Earn Rewards For Care!
Taking care of chronic conditions and mental health is essential, and Sunshine Health rewards members for completing important health check-ups and follow-ups. Here’s how you can earn rewards while staying on top of your health.
- Dilated Eye Exam – If you have diabetes, completing a dilated eye exam once per year helps protect your vision. By doing this, you can earn $10 annually, ensuring you stay proactive about your eye health while managing your condition effectively.
- HbA1c Test – Monitoring blood sugar is crucial for those with diabetes (ages 18-75). Completing a HbA1c test once per year allows you to earn $20 annually, helping you take control of your diabetes while getting rewarded for prioritizing your health.
- Hematologist Visits – Members diagnosed with sickle cell disease can earn $20 per year by completing two hematologist visits annually. These check-ups help manage the condition effectively while ensuring access to necessary medical care and ongoing monitoring.
- Mental Health Follow-Up After Inpatient Admission – If you’re 6 years or older, completing an outpatient follow-up with a behavioral health provider within 7 days of hospital discharge earns you $20 (twice per year), helping you stay on track with your mental well-being.

FAQS:
Can I use my Sunshine Health Rewards Card to pay for prescription medications?
No, the card cannot be used for prescription medications. It is specifically meant for approved expenses, including utilities, rent, transportation, childcare, education, and shopping at Walmart for eligible items. Always check the spending guidelines before use.
How long does it take for my rewards to be added to my card?
Rewards are typically added after your provider’s claim is processed, which may take a few weeks. To track your rewards, log into your Sunshine Health member account or use the mobile app for real-time updates on your balance.
Can I give my card to a family member to use?
No, the Sunshine Health Rewards Card is non-transferable and can only be used by the registered member. If you need to use rewards for household expenses, you must make the payment yourself using the card at an approved location.
What should I do if my Sunshine Health Rewards Card is lost or stolen?
If your card is lost or stolen, contact Sunshine Health Member Services immediately to report the issue. You may request a replacement card, but processing and delivery times may vary, so act quickly to avoid disruptions in using rewards.
Do my rewards expire if I don’t use them?
Yes, some rewards may expire if not used within a set period. To avoid losing them, check your Sunshine Health account regularly or contact customer service to understand the expiration policy and ensure timely usage of your rewards.
